#71fac0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#71fac0 is composed of 44.3% red, 98% green and 75.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 54.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 23.2% yellow and 2% black. It has a hue angle of 154.6 degrees, a saturation of 93.2% and a lightness of 71.2%. #71fac0 color hex could be obtained by blending #e2ffff with #00f581. Closest websafe color is: #66ffcc.

#71fac0 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#71fac0 has RGB values of R:113, G:250, B:192 and CMYK values of C:0.55, M:0, Y:0.23,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 7469760.

Shades and Tints of #71fac0
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000a06 is the darkest color, while #f6fffb is the lightest one.

Tones of #71fac0
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b5b6b6 is the less saturated color, while #71fac0 is the most saturated one.
